package org.wahlzeit.model;
import org.wahlzeit.utils.EnumValue;
/**
* An AccessRight is an enum value that represents a defined level of access. Possible access levels are none, guest,
* user, moderator, and administrator. However, higher levels of access subsume lower levels of access rights. How they
* are handled depends on the application.
*/
public enum AccessRights implements EnumValue {
/**
*
*/
NONE(0), GUEST(1), USER(2), MODERATOR(3), ADMINISTRATOR(4);
/**
*
*/
private static AccessRights[] allValues = {
NONE, GUEST, USER, MODERATOR, ADMINISTRATOR
};
/**
*
*/
public static AccessRights getFromInt(int myValue) throws IllegalArgumentException {
assertIsValidIntValue(myValue);
return allValues[myValue];
}
/**
*
*/
private static final String[] valueNames = {
"none", "guest", "user", "moderator", "administrator"
};
/**
*
*/
public static AccessRights getFromString(String myRights) throws IllegalArgumentException {
for (AccessRights rights : AccessRights.values()) {
if (valueNames[rights.asInt()].equals(myRights)) {
return rights;
}
}
thro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id AccessRight string: " + myRights);
}
/**
*
*/
private int value;
/**
*
*/
AccessRights(int myValue) {
value = myValue;
}
/**
* @methodtype conversion
*/
public int asInt() {
return value;
}
/**
* @methodtype conversion
*/
public String asString() {
return valueNames[value];
}
/**
* @methodtype get
*/
public AccessRights[] getAllValues() {
return allValues;
}
/**
* @methodtype get
*/
public String getTypeName() {
return "AccessRights";
}
/**
* @methodtype comparison
*/
public static boolean hasRights(AccessRights a, AccessRights b) {
return a.value >= b.value;
}
/**
* @methodtype assertion
*/
private static void assertIsValidIntValue(int myValue) {
if ((myValue < 0) || (myValue > 4)) {
thro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id AccessRights int: " + myValue);
}
}
}
